Jun 30, 2022 Jon Ivanco, co-founder of Formtoro and e‑commerce/product strategist, helps brands gather zero- and first‑party data and design quiz-style customer experiences. The conversation dives into customer psychology, timing and messaging, quiz-driven commerce, reducing checkout friction, and why treating marketing as predictive customer support can upend stale e-commerce habits.

Collect Data To Serve Customers Not Just Ads
- Brands must use zero and first party data to service customers, not just to weaponize marketing.
- FormToro began as SaaS but pivoted to combine tech plus consultancy because teams lacked strategy to leverage collected data.
Privacy Changes Favor Big Platforms
- Privacy moves by big platforms are strategic, often to entrench their first-party data advantages.
- Jon links Apple's privacy and payment moves (Apple Pay) to broader control over checkout and data flows.
Give Value Immediately To Reduce Friction
- Reduce gating friction: deliver value immediately like unique on-the-spot coupons instead of forcing email capture.
- Jon created multi-use coupons generated on the fly to let users redeem quickly and reveal true behavior without bias.
